Output 76f80c17eebffcb9519062faf0792dd76e4a6a6e583bf3b71fb59eef7fbdf653:0

value
25702416
script pubkey
OP_0 OP_PUSHBYTES_20 2e9bfb80a47885e72888eff12174f1c23426dbf2
address
bc1q96dlhq9y0zz7w2ygalcjza83cg6zdkljj9c409
transaction
76f80c17eebffcb9519062faf0792dd76e4a6a6e583bf3b71fb59eef7fbdf653
spent
true